What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Atlanta to Bangor?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Atlanta to Bangor cl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

Your flight ticket price will generally be cheaper if you fly to Bangor on a Saturday and more expensive on a Sunday. On your return trip to Atlanta, you should consider flying back on a Wednesday, and avoid Saturdays for better deals.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Atlanta to Bangor?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Atlanta to Bangor,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Atlanta to Bangor is February, where tickets cost $338 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are April and December,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$755 and $595 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Atlanta to Bangor?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Atlanta to Bangor,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Atlanta to Bangor, you should book around 4 weeks before departure, which saves you about 42%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 25 weeks before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Atlanta to Bangor?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Bangor with an airline and back to Atlanta with another airline. Booking your flights between Atlanta and BGR can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
